      Business Analyst Interview

      Dec 2, 2015
      Anonymous employee
      Brookfield, WI
      Accepted offer
      Negative exper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ied through an employee referral. I interviewed at Connecture (Brookfield, WI)

      Interview

      The first interview was with 4 people (2 people at a time). It was the standard questions (except they didn't asked the 5-year question, which was nice). I interviewed with 2 PM's and 2 Business Analysts. After those interviews, I came back in for one more interview with the Director. That interview was very short. He was basically making sure he liked me.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      Past job experiences; client-facing interactions, research and analysis skills, tools used, SDLC experience, waterfall approach experience.

      Business Analyst Interview

      Jan 25, 2015
      Anonymous employee
      Accepted offer
      Positive experience

      Application

      I applied through an employee referral.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at Connecture

      Interview

      There were several phone interviews with an outside staffing agency representing Connecture. Normal type screening questions. Then after the phone screens, an onsite was scheduled with 2 interviews and one on the phone. I received an offer several days later and signed it within 3 days.
